cutless bearings?

Hi all,

Need to replace our countless bearing and have read on the forum that they are 1"1/4, but I measure ours at 1"1/8 ????????
Can anyone throw any light on this for me?
We also want to fit a rope cutter and need the size for that.

Any help regarding the bearing issue would be most appreciated.

Re: cutless bearings?

Hi.  Saiia  is No 55, and Twotails is No 21, but I doubt very much if the shaft diameter was changed.  I happen to have a short section of the cutless bearing I installed, have measured it this morning, and it's dimensions are - I.D. 1.25",  O.D. 1.75".

Re: cutless bearings?

Hi. A general comment. (Teaching my grandmother........etc!)   Anyone replacing a cutless bearing should remember to drill 2 holes in the new item so to align with the water intakes on each side of the casting holding it, thus providing the lubrication.
